Mapping the End-to-End Hotel Booking Lifecycle with Intelligent Workflow Logic
Modern travel platforms rely on seamless, intuitive user experiences — and behind every smooth booking process lies a well-structured system design. The AI Activity Diagram generator in Visual Paradigm enables teams to rapidly model complex workflows like hotel reservations, transforming high-level ideas into precise, actionable diagrams through natural conversation.
With the ability to generate professional UML activity diagrams in seconds, Visual Paradigm’s AI-powered visual modeling platform supports end-to-end system design across multiple standards — including UML, ArchiMate, SysML, C4, and mind maps. This capability is especially valuable when visualizing user-centric processes such as hotel bookings, where clarity, branching logic, and error handling are critical.

How the System Handles Payment Success and Failure Paths
The generated activity diagram captures not just the standard flow of a hotel booking, but also the nuanced decision points that define real-world resilience. From searching available rooms to finalizing payment, each step is clearly defined — with special attention to error recovery and user feedback.
When a user attempts to book a room, the system first validates input data and processes payment through a secure gateway. If the payment fails, the workflow doesn’t terminate abruptly — instead, it enters a retry loop with a maximum of three attempts. This design prevents user frustration and increases conversion rates by allowing temporary issues (like network timeouts) to be resolved without requiring a full restart.
If all retry attempts fail, the system escalates the issue by offering alternative payment methods. Only after exhausting all options does the system cancel the booking and inform the user — ensuring transparency and trust.
Behind the Scenes: How Confirmation Emails Are Generated
One of the most frequently asked questions during diagram review was: How is the confirmation email generated? The answer lies in the integration of backend services triggered after successful payment.
Once the booking and payment are confirmed, a dedicated email service is activated. This service pulls data from the reservation system — including guest details, room type, dates, and pricing — and populates a pre-defined template. The system dynamically personalizes the message with the guest’s name and unique booking reference, then sends it via a secure email provider like SendGrid or Amazon SES.
This automation ensures consistency, reduces manual work, and provides users with immediate confirmation. The process is also logged for audit purposes, so support teams can trace any issues that may arise.

Why This Workflow Matters for Travel Platforms
For travel booking applications, reliability and user experience are inseparable. A single failed step — especially during payment — can lead to lost bookings and diminished trust. The activity diagram illustrates how intelligent workflow design anticipates these failures and provides graceful recovery paths.
By using the Visual Paradigm AI Chatbot, teams can prototype, refine, and document these workflows through simple conversation. Users can ask for clarifications, request modifications, or even generate follow-up diagrams — such as a sequence diagram for the email generation process — all in real time.
The Logical Next Step: Build, Refine, and Scale
Whether you’re designing a new travel platform or optimizing an existing one, having a clear, AI-generated visual model is essential. The ability to iterate through natural language prompts — like asking, “Can you explain how the confirmation email is generated?” — turns complex system logic into accessible insights.
Take the next step in your design journey with the Visual Paradigm AI Chatbot and start building intelligent, scalable workflows today.
